When it comes to sealing joints and gaps in construction projects, one product stands out among the rest – sealant sikaflex. Manufactured by Sika Corporation, Sikaflex is a polyurethane-based sealant that offers unparalleled strength, durability, and flexibility. In this article, we will explore the many benefits of using Sikaflex in various applications, as well as provide tips for proper application and maintenance.

One of the key benefits of using Sikaflex sealant is its exceptional adhesion to a wide variety of substrates, including concrete, metal, wood, and plastics. This makes it an ideal choice for sealing joints in building facades, expansion joints in concrete structures, and seams in metal roofing. The strong bond created by Sikaflex ensures a watertight seal that will withstand the test of time, even in harsh weather conditions.

In addition to its superior adhesion, Sikaflex also offers excellent flexibility, allowing it to move and stretch with the building materials as they expand and contract due to temperature changes. This flexibility helps prevent cracks and leaks from forming in the joint sealant over time, ensuring long-lasting performance and protection.

Another advantage of using Sikaflex sealant is its resistance to UV rays, extreme temperatures, and chemicals. This makes it ideal for outdoor applications where exposure to the elements is a concern, such as sealing joints in parking garages, bridges, and sidewalks. Sikaflex will not degrade or lose its flexibility when exposed to sunlight, rain, snow, or harsh chemicals, making it a reliable choice for demanding projects.

When it comes to application, proper preparation is key to ensuring a successful seal. Before applying Sikaflex sealant, the joint must be clean, dry, and free of any dust, dirt, or contaminants. Any existing sealant or adhesive residue should be removed, and the joint should be primed if necessary to promote adhesion. Once the joint is properly prepared, Sikaflex can be applied using a standard caulking gun, making it easy and convenient to use on any project.

After application, Sikaflex sealant should be tooled to ensure a smooth, uniform seal. This can be done using a plastic spatula or tool dipped in a soap and water solution to prevent the sealant from sticking. Once tooled, Sikaflex should be allowed to cure according to the manufacturer’s instructions, typically within 24 hours for full adhesion and strength.

Once cured, Sikaflex sealant requires minimal maintenance to ensure long-lasting performance. Regular inspections should be conducted to check for any signs of wear, damage, or deterioration in the sealant. Any cracks or gaps that develop should be repaired promptly to prevent water infiltration and further damage to the building materials. With proper maintenance, Sikaflex sealant can provide reliable protection and sealing for many years to come.
